Franklin County supervisors adopted the VDOT secondary six‑year plan and prioritized projects including Red Valley, Novella, Webster Road and others; staff said the revised Red Valley approach (pave ends) kept projects on the list within funding.

The Franklin County Board of Supervisors adopted the Virginia Department of Transportation (VDOT) secondary six‑year plan (fiscal years 2026–2031) after a VDOT representative reviewed the county’s prioritized paving projects.
